Coalition’s artillery burns 4 homes in Hodeidah

Coalition-backed mercenaries on Tuesday fired artillery shells at Hodeidah province, a security official told Yemen Press Agency. The shelling burned four homes and destroyed nearby homes in 7 July area, added the official.
